In the fruit fly Drosophila, a rudimentary wing called vestigial and the dark body color called ebony are inherited at independent loci and are recessive to their dominant wild type counterparts, full wing and gray body color. Dihybrid males and females displaying both wild type phenotypes are crossed, and 3200 progeny are produced. How many progeny flies are expected in each of the phenotypic classes produced?
